Overview

MyFitnessPal logs food and exercise against calorie and macronutrient goals, backed by one of the largest food databases available. It suits anyone tracking diet for weight or fitness goals. Barcode scanning and recipe importing speed up daily logging.

Pros & cons

What we like

  • Enormous food and restaurant database
  • Fast barcode scanning
  • Detailed macro and nutrient tracking
  • Integrates with many fitness apps

Worth noting

  • Key features moved behind a subscription
  • Database includes user-entered errors
  • Ads clutter the free experience
